Half Vollering fell heavily a few kilometers from the finish this Monday during the 3rd stage of the 2025 women’s Tour de France, leaving the uncertainty over the rest of his adventure on the big loop. Furthermore, The boss of the FDJ-Suez, the Dutch team, pushed a rant after the race.

Perhaps one of the turns of this 2025 women’s Tour de France. Furthermore, Half Vollering, one of the favorites, was involved in a fall this Monday during the third stage. Therefore, An incident that could leave traces in his second coronation quest on the big loop. Meanwhile, After the race, fear has given way to anger in the FDJ-Suez clan, the Dutch team.

“We cannot manage the behaviors of some that have taken too many risks. Similarly, I cannot blame them. there is so much importance on this Tour de France,” first “a real lack respect peloton”, tempered the manager of the French team Stephen Delcourt. “Afterwards, we cannot master the trajectories of our opponents. I just would like to emphasize that there is a real lack of respect in the peloton. We said it on the Tour de France male too. but we have seen behaviors of certain teams where there is no more respect for the leaders, there is no more respect for certain sprinters and I would like to pass a real face because with ASO) (Monday) morning: the athletes themselves create dangers “.

Stephen Delcourt also returned to the physical. mental state of her taulter after her fall: “She is clearly shocked. A fall at such a speed, especially when you are concentrated hanging for several hours. You have to let the shock pass. we are lucky to have a big medical team around it that will take the “a real lack respect peloton”, time. If it is a muscle pain due to the shock. it can be done, but we will make the decision tomorrow (Tuesday) But we want to remain positive. “

Half Vollering currently occupies sixth place in the general classification at 19 “of the leader Marianne Vos. It remains to be seen now whether the FDJ-Suez runner will be able to recover from this fall which left her lively knee. buttock pain. The French team will decide this Tuesday morning if he lets the Dutch take the road while Stephen Delcourt. recalled that his” physical integrity “was the priority.
